Make a list of all the positive outcomes you expect from making a change and the negative outcomes of not making it.
Try to come up with these reasons yourself to make it more effective.

Don't waste time dreaming about being a changed person.
Instead, use your imagination to visualize how you want to bring about that change into your life. This can boost your performance.

Try and be aware of your emotions at all times, and learn to manage them.
Don't bottle up your emotions and try to suppress them.
Exercise can be helpful to improve mental and emotional health.

Spend more time with positive and supportive people who will help you make that change. Try to find a partner who wants to make a similar change, and support and motivate each other.
Try and avoid people who might distract and demotivate you from chasing your goals.

Write down plans and steps to implement your changes and to accomplish your goals.
Keep it very detailed by including time, place and also a backup plan in case the initial plan fails.
Example:
I will wake up at 5am and go to the gym to exercise...
